Technical Field
The utility model relates to a civil engineering technical field specifically is a safety device is used in civil engineering construction.
Background
In building construction, firstly, the most important is safety, a large number of accidents occur on construction sites every year, people pay attention to safety measures of civil engineering construction, and the guard rail is necessary equipment for each dangerous place and has the functions of warning and protection.
However, the existing safety protection devices are various in types, different guard railings are used in different dangerous places, and the height cannot be adjusted, so that guard railings with different sizes need to be purchased, the cost is increased, the existing safety guard railings only have single function, only can play the functions of warning and protection, have small functions, are integrated with most guard railings, cannot be detached, and occupy large space.

2. The safety device for civil engineering construction according to claim 1, characterized in that: the first rectangular groove (3) and the second rectangular groove (4) are symmetrical with respect to the center line of the base (1).
3. The safety device for civil engineering construction according to claim 1, characterized in that: the diameters of the first threaded hole (5) and the second fixing hole (8) and the diameters of the limiting hole (7) and the second threaded hole (11) are respectively equal, and the central lines of the first threaded hole and the second threaded hole are respectively on the same straight line.
4. The safety device for civil engineering construction according to claim 1, characterized in that: the second rectangular groove (4) is connected with the side plate (6) in a clamping manner, and the side plate (6) is connected with the transverse plate (9) in a clamping manner.
5. The safety device for civil engineering construction according to claim 1, characterized in that: the transverse plate (9) and the loop bar (13) are respectively in sleeve connection with the sleeve (12), and the loop bar (13) is connected with the transverse rod (15) in an embedded mode.
